Summary, etc. | Community is a recurring topic in research touching on digital cultures. Yet this notion is not specifically linked to computer-mediated communication. Differences between society and community must be stressed, especially in reference to the works of Tönnies, who describes the former as an instrumental rationality-oriented process and the latter as a self-sufficient experience. Several authors addressing online interactions have highlighted, sometimes in almost mystical terms, the strength of digital togetherness. In this paper, virtual community is embedded in a social and historical context of deep transformations of real-life social cohesion. |
